What Are Downpipes?
Downpipes are vertical pipes that channel rainwater from the roof of a structure to the ground drainage system. They are vital in ensuring efficient water runoff, preventing possible water damage to walls, foundations, and landscaping.

The Installation Process
The setup of downpipes generally includes a series of systematic actions:
Step 1: Planning
Before setup, a comprehensive evaluation of the home's drainage needs is needed. Factors to consider consist of:
- Roof Area: The size of the roof directly affects the quantity of rainwater that needs to be drained pipes.
- Area of Downpipes: Strategically placing downpipes guarantees effective water runoff and prevents pooling.
Step 2: Material Selection
Selecting the ideal materials is important. Typical materials for downpipes include:
- PVC: Lightweight and cost-efficient, PVC is a popular choice but might not be as durable as metal.
- Metal: Steel or aluminum downpipes are more robust and long-lasting, frequently chosen in residential settings.
Step 3: Installation
- Mark the Location: Use a level to mark where the downpipes will be set up.
- Cutting and Fitting: Cut the downpipe areas to the required lengths, making sure a snug fit.
- Connecting to the Roof: Secure the downpipe to the roof's gutter system.
- Linking to the Drainage System: Ensure the downpipe leads directly to the drainage or rainwater harvesting system.
- Sealing and Testing: Seal all joints and connections and test for leakages.
Step 4: Final Inspection
After setup, a thorough assessment makes sure everything is working properly. Installers typically use tools like electronic cameras to check internal pathways for obstructions.
Upkeep Tips for Downpipes
Proper maintenance can extend the lifespan of downpipes. Here are some suggestions:
- Regular Cleaning: Remove debris from seamless gutters and downpipes to prevent blockages.
- Visual Inspections: Regularly inspect for rust, fractures, and indications of wear and tear.
- Emergency Checks: After heavy rains, examine for leakages or pooling around the structure's foundation.
Frequently Asked Questions About Downpipe Installation
1. Just how much does downpipe setup normally cost?
The expense of downpipe installation can differ commonly based upon aspects such as the material utilized, the intricacy of the setup, and regional prices differences. Typically, house owners can expect to pay in between ₤ 200 and ₤ 1,200.
2. How long does the installation process take?
The timeline for setup varies depending on the job's size and intricacy. A typical domestic setup can take anywhere from a few hours to a full day.
3. Can I install downpipes myself?
While DIY installation is possible, it's suggested to work with professionals for finest results. Misinstallations can lead to major water damage.
4. What are the indications of a stopping working downpipe?
Common signs of stopping working downpipes consist of water pooling around the foundation, noticeable rust or damage, and regular gutter overflow during rainfall.
